Book Boundary Detection from Bookshelf Image Based on Model Fitting

Several systems based on bookshelf image analysis have been studied for automating bookshelf inspection in libraries and bookstores. In conventional systems, book boundaries are firstly detected for extracting each individual book by using some popular line detection technique, such as Hough transformation. Their detection accuracies, however, are sometimes insufficient. In this paper, we propose a model-based book boundary detection technique for higher detection accuracy. The model is represented as a finite state automaton, each of whose states corresponds to a component of bookshelves, such as boundary and title. With this model, the book boundary detection problem is formulated as a model-based optimization problem where states and local slant angles at all horizontal positions were variables to be optimized. The globally optimal solution is efficiently searched for using a dynamic programming based algorithm. The effectiveness of the proposed technique was shown by several experiments.
